
18/06/2008, 07:18
|
 | | | Fecha de Ingreso: septiembre-2007 Ubicación: Guatemala
Mensajes: 130
Antigüedad: 17 años, 5 meses Puntos: 0 | |
Respuesta: Ayuda, pasar datos de pop up a pantalla padre Aqui esta el código de mi página (de form a form), dado que la parte de <script> ya se las comente.
Código:
<form id="frmbusqueda" runat="server">
<div>
<asp:ScriptManager ID="ScriptManager1" runat="server">
</asp:ScriptManager>
</div>
<asp:UpdatePanel ID="UpdatePanel1" runat="server" RenderMode="Inline">
<ContentTemplate>
<table width="800">
<tr>
<td>
<asp:Label ID="lbltitulo" runat="server" Text="Búsqueda de articulos por descrpción"
Font-Bold="true" Font-Names="tahoma" Font-Size="16pt">
</asp:Label>
</td>
</tr>
<tr>
<td height="10"></td>
</tr>
<tr width="100%">
<td>
<asp:Label ID="lbldescripcion" runat="server" Text="Ingrese la descripción del articulo que desea y oprima buscar, el sistema únicamente le desplegará los que esten en existencia."
Font-Names="tahoma" Font-Size="10pt">
</asp:Label>
</td>
</tr>
<tr>
<td height="10"></td>
</tr>
<tr>
<td>
<asp:Label ID="lbldesc" runat="server" Text ="Descripción:" Font-Bold="true"
font-names="tahoma" Font-Size="12pt">
</asp:Label>
</td>
</tr>
<tr width="100%">
<td>
<asp:TextBox ID="txtdescri" runat="server" Width="232px"></asp:TextBox>
<asp:Button ID="btnbuscar" runat="server" Text="Buscar" OnClick="btnbuscar_Click" />
<input id="btnaceptar" type="button" value="Aceptar" onclick="PasarDatos()"/>
</td>
</tr>
<tr>
<td height="10">
<asp:Label ID="Label1" runat="server" Font-Names="Tahoma" Font-Size="10pt" Text='Seleccione el articulo deseado y oprima el botón "Aceptar".'></asp:Label>
</td>
</tr>
<tr width="100%">
<td>
<asp:UpdatePanel ID="UpdatePanel2" runat="server">
<ContentTemplate>
<asp:GridView ID="GridView1" runat="server" CellPadding="3" ForeColor="#333333"
Width="97%" AllowPaging="True"
OnPageIndexChanging="GridView1_PageIndexChanging" OnSelectedIndexChanged="GridView1_SelectedIndexChanged"
PageSize="8" AutoGenerateColumns="False" DataKeyNames="Código" DataSourceID="busqueda">
<FooterStyle BackColor="#507CD1" Font-Bold="True" ForeColor="White" />
<Columns>
<asp:CommandField ButtonType="Button" SelectText="Seleccionar" ShowSelectButton="True" />
<asp:BoundField DataField="Código" HeaderText="Código" SortExpression="Código">
<ItemStyle Width="15%" />
</asp:BoundField>
<asp:BoundField DataField="Descripción" HeaderText="Descripción" SortExpression="Descripción">
<ItemStyle HorizontalAlign="Left" Width="72%" />
</asp:BoundField>
<asp:BoundField DataField="Existencia" HeaderText="Existencia" SortExpression="Existencia">
<ItemStyle HorizontalAlign="Right" Width="10%" />
</asp:BoundField>
</Columns>
<RowStyle BackColor="#EFF3FB" />
<EditRowStyle BackColor="#2461BF" />
<SelectedRowStyle BackColor="#D1DDF1" Font-Bold="True" ForeColor="#333333" />
<PagerStyle BackColor="#2461BF" ForeColor="White" HorizontalAlign="Center" />
<HeaderStyle BackColor="#507CD1" Font-Bold="True" ForeColor="White" />
<AlternatingRowStyle BackColor="White" />
</asp:GridView>
<asp:SqlDataSource ID="busqueda" runat="server" ConnectionString="<%$ ConnectionStrings:INDIRECTOConnectionString %>"
SelectCommand="SELECT a.ARTICULO AS Código, a.DESCRIPCION AS Descripción, COUNT(a.ARTICULO) AS Existencia FROM Refrigua.REFRIGUA.ARTICULO AS a INNER JOIN Refrigua.REFRIGUA.EXISTENCIA_BODEGA AS e ON a.ARTICULO = e.ARTICULO WHERE (a.TIPO = 'U') AND (e.CANT_DISPONIBLE > 0) AND (a.DESCRIPCION LIKE '%' + @dato + '%') GROUP BY a.ARTICULO, a.DESCRIPCION, a.COSTO_PROM_LOC, a.UNIDAD_ALMACEN">
<SelectParameters>
<asp:FormParameter DefaultValue="" FormField="txtdescri" Name="dato" Type="String" />
</SelectParameters>
</asp:SqlDataSource>
</ContentTemplate>
</asp:UpdatePanel>
</td>
</tr>
<tr width="100%">
<td>
Aqui estan los input donde declaro los parametros que le paso al jscript
<input id="articulos" type="hidden" runat="server" />
<input id="descripcion" type="hidden" runat="server" />
<input id="centcost" type="hidden" runat="server" />
<input id="um" type="hidden" runat="server" />
<input id="pantalla" type="hidden" runat="server" />
</td>
</tr>
</table>
</ContentTemplate>
</asp:UpdatePanel>
</form>
Saludos
__________________ 死は永遠の一歩だ |